Delegating tasks and responsibilities to a team can be an effective way to manage workloads and ensure that projects are completed efficiently. Here are some tips for effective delegation:
1. Clearly define tasks and expectations: When delegating tasks, be sure to clearly define what needs to be done, how it should be done, and what the expected outcome is. Make sure your team understands the importance of the task and how it fits into the overall project or goal.
2. Choose the right people: When delegating tasks, it's important to choose the right people for the job. Look for team members who have the necessary skills, experience, and interest in the task at hand. Be sure to provide any necessary training or resources to help them succeed.
3. Provide support and guidance: When delegating tasks, it's important to provide support and guidance to your team. Check in regularly to see how things are going, offer feedback and advice as needed, and be available to answer any questions or concerns.
4. Set deadlines and expectations: Be sure to set clear deadlines and expectations for the task or project. Make sure your team understands the timeline and what is expected of them. Provide regular updates on progress and adjust deadlines as needed.
5. Trust your team: Delegating tasks requires a certain amount of trust in your team. Trust that they have the skills and expertise to complete the task, and trust that they will communicate any issues or challenges along the way.
By following these tips, you can effectively delegate tasks and responsibilities to your team, freeing up your time and ensuring that projects are completed efficiently and effectively.
